Ordinals
beta
Address 18JbEjPfQSKwq9zFj6oRkbNmKcVvzByfCs
sat balance
100000
outputs
e56dccb31aaaa9e08c0732b9e202184b4f5e31c574708ece32f4ed490b23cd7e:290